  • The Green Ray
    Jules Verne / Mary De Hauteville
    The Green Ray is a novel by Jules Verne, first published in 1882. The story follows the journey of Helena Campbell, a young woman who is searching for the elusive ''green ray'' - a rare optical phenomenon that occurs at sunset, when the sun briefly turns green before disappearing below the horizon. Helena is determined to witness this event, believing that it will bring her tru...

  • The Blockade Runners
    Jules Verne / Verne Jules Verne
    Jules Verne (February 8, 1828-March 24, 1905) was a French writer. He is best know for his science-fiction novels such as Twenty Thousand Leagues Under The Sea (1870), Journey To The Center Of The Earth (1864), and Around the World in Eighty Days (1873). He was writing about space. underwater and air travel before air travel and submarines were actually invented. He is one the ...
